 Using PocketD inside Windows
 ----------------------------
 The menu-driven interface "MenuD" for PocketD Plus is not a Windows
 application, but can be easily used from within Windows. It will
 support a Microsoft mouse, but only if a mouse driver has already
 been installed (e.g. MOUSE.COM or MOUSE.SYS). The mouse interface
 is optimised for efficient use within MenuD rather than the more
 common Windows-style usage.

 What is PocketD used for?
 -------------------------
 PocketD allows the user to look for, browse, examine, copy and
 manipulate files with the flexibility of a programming language. It
 is astonishingly powerful for performing operations for which there
 is no other reasonable solution.
 
 Documentation?
 --------------
 MenuD provides full access to the on-line guide and manual which
 describes each of the 220 options in detail and provides worked
 examples. The install disk also includes printable documentation
 files giving quick examples, network management uses and a general
 introduction.
 
 The registered version comes with a comprehensive bound 110-page
 pocket-sized manual which is packed with many example applications
 from common day-to-day disk and network management to exotic
 examples such as the automatic generation of C source code.
